Septembers Coffee of the Month Origin: Ethiopia, Africa Body: Medium-bodied Roast: Light Roast (1) Summary of taste: Sweet, fruity & floral Whittard recommends: Using a filter, cafetire or pour over & enjoying black When to drink: Throughout the day In Ethiopia, coffee (known as bunna) plays an integral role in social & cultural life, not least in the elaborate ceremonies where the beans are roasted in huge metal pans over an open fire. Grown close to the home of the first coffee bean, the coffee grown around the tiny town of Yirgacheffe in Southern Ethiopia has an extraordinarily distinctive flavour profile, characterised by aromatic floral notes & mild lemon acidity. Wet-processed according to traditional methods, this light-bodied coffee has a silky smooth sweetness, winning it three gold stars in the 2012 Great Taste Awards. In the words of the judges? Good Yirgacheffe fruit. Great peach flavour. We couldnt agree more.
